THE OPPORTUNITY:
We are looking for Service Sprinkler Fitter to join our Sprinkler Construction Division full-time. As a Service Sprinkler Fitter, you will install, service, and repair Fire Protection Sprinkler Systems with a focus on new construction and tenant improvements (commercial and multi-unit residential).
